Making an appointment for an appraisal

Once you have received an initial valuation from us, simply contact one of our branches and book a day and time that suits you.

Remember, your appointment with us for an appraisal is free and there is no obligation to sell your vehicle

  • Your Vehicle You will need to bring your vehicle so we can give it a quick check over
  • V5 Logbook This is the registration document for your vehicle also known as the logbook. It will need to be in your name so as we know you are the registered keeper or have the permission of the legal owner to sell the vehicle if you choose to do so
  • Service History If your vehicle has any service history, please bring this with you as no service history will have an adverse effect on the vehicles value
  • MOT Certificate Only vehicles 3 years and older require a valid MOT. If your vehicle has an MOT certificate, please bring this along. If you don’t have the MOT certificate we can carry out a check online
  • Finance Details If your vehicle has any outstanding finance, then please bring your finance details with a settlement figure, we can help you get the settlement figure if you would prefer
  • Both Sets of Keys Please bring both sets of keys for your vehicle. Our valuation is based on the vehicle having 2 sets of keys. Don't worry if you don't have both sets, but please let us know when you bring your vehicle in.
  • Vehicle Extras We will need any other extra bits that your vehicle comes with, such as locking wheel nuts, security codes for car entertainment systems, satellite navigation systems disc/cards
  • Bank Details If you choose to sell your vehicle, then having your bank details speeds up the process. The bank account should be in the name of the registered keeper otherwise we require the legal owners consent.

  • Two Forms of Identification You will need identification with your current address such as a utility bill or council tax letter and this must match the address on the V5 document. You should also bring in photo identification such as passport or driving license. Identification must be original copies

When we buy your car, we will make payments directly into your bank. All banks differ but the usual standard transfer is within 3 working days.

The banks do offer a faster payment service on the same or next working day. The price of these services is out of our control and is set by the banks and the charge paid to them will be deducted from the agreed price. Please let us know if you wish or need to use one of the bank faster payment services and we will arrange this for you and give you all the details of bank charges and timescales.

If your car has a private plate then yes we can still buy it. 

However, if you want to keep or retain your private plate then you will need to place it on retention via DVLA or assign it to another vehicle. We will happily help with this process.

You will have to pay the current DVLA fee to retain a private plate which is £80.00. This process may delay the transfer of funds in to your bank for the sale of the vehicle until all documents are returned from DVLA.
